import Foundation
let pattern = #"^[A-Z-0-9]+ .*(?<type>chore|ci|docs|feat|fix|perf|refactor|revert|style|test|¯\\_\(ツ\)_\/¯)(?<scope>\(\w+\)?((?=:\s)|(?=!:\s)))?(?<breaking>!)?(?<subject>:\s.*)?|^(?<merge>Merge.* \w+)|^(?<revert>Revert.* \w+)"#
let regex = try! NSRegularExpression(pattern: pattern, options: .anchorsMatchLines)
let testString = ####"""
### Should Pass Test
NV-1234 chore: change build progress
DT-123456 docs: update xdemo usage
QA-123 ci: update jenkins automatic backup
CC-1234 feat: new fucntional about sync
Merge branch master into develop
Reverted: Revert "support UV113 feature & bugfix branches make full build
Merge pull request #36 in cicd from test to developSquashed commit of the following: com
### Failed to match test
NV-1234 build: update
NV-1234 Chore: change progress
DT-123456 Docs: update xdemo
QA-123ci: update jenkins automatic backup
CC-1234 Feat: new fucntional about sync
DT-17734: 8.2.2 merge from CF1/2- Enhance PORT.STATUS to identify Python processes initiated
DT-17636 fix AIX cord dump issue
DT-18183 Fix the UDTHOME problem for secure telnet
DT-18183 Add new condition to get UDTHOME
DT-15567 code merge by Peter Shen.
"""####
let stringRange = NSRange(location: 0, length: testString.utf16.count)
let matches = regex.matches(in: testString, range: stringRange)
var result: [[String]] = []
for match in matches {
var groups: [String] = []
for rangeIndex in 1 ..< match.numberOfRanges {
let nsRange = match.range(at: rangeIndex)
guard !NSEqualRanges(nsRange, NSMakeRange(NSNotFound, 0)) else { continue }
let string = (testString as NSString).substring(with: nsRange)
groups.append(string)
}
if !groups.isEmpty {
result.append(groups)
}
}
print(result)
